Understanding the Odds: Decoding Probability in Gambling
To fully immerse yourself in the world of gambling, grasping the concept of probability is crucial. Every game you encounter, from the spinning wheel of roulette to the roll of the dice, operates on defined odds that influence your chances of winning or losing. Understanding these odds can elevate your strategic approach. The probability of an event can be expressed as a fraction, decimal, or percentage, giving you a clearer comprehension of what to expect. In many cases, these numbers can be directly correlated to your potential payout, revealing the inherent risk involved. Here are some key points to keep in mind:
- Probabilities Influence Payouts: Higher odds often mean lower payouts, and vice versa.
- House Edge: Most games favor the house, which is why understanding the odds can help you play smarter.
- Situational Awareness: Different games have different dynamics – don’t apply the same probability logic across the board.
Another vital aspect of probability in gambling is recognizing the difference between independent and dependent events. Independent events, like the outcomes of roulette spins, are not affected by previous results. Conversely, dependent events, exemplified by certain card games, have outcomes that change based on prior actions and choices. To illustrate this, consider the following table:
Event Type | Example | Impact on Odds |
---|---|---|
Independent | Roulette Spin | No impact from previous spins |
Dependent | Blackjack Hands | Previous cards affect future outcomes |
By recognizing these nuances, you can start making informed decisions that align with the rules of probability, improving your overall experience and potentially your profit margins in gambling.
Choosing the Right Games: A Beginners Perspective on Casino Options
As a beginner stepping into the exhilarating world of casinos, it’s crucial to explore the variety of games available before placing your bets. Each game comes with its unique atmosphere and rules, which may appeal to different styles of play. Here are some popular options to consider:
- Slots: Easy to play and require no prior experience, making them perfect for newbies.
- Blackjack: Combines strategy with luck, offering players a chance to improve their skill over time.
- Roulette: A game of chance that captivates with its spinning wheel and vibrant betting options.
- Poker: Requires more skill and strategy, allowing you to compete against other players.
Understanding the basic rules and potential payouts of each game can significantly enhance your gambling experience. It’s also important to consider your personal preferences and budget when choosing which games to try. Here’s a helpful comparison table to guide your decision:
Game | Skill Level | House Edge | Social Interaction |
---|---|---|---|
Slots | Low | 3% – 10% | Minimal |
Blackjack | Medium | 0.5% – 1% | Moderate |
Roulette | Low | 2.5% – 7% | Minimal |
Poker | High | Variable | High |
Bankroll Management: Strategies to Extend Your Playtime
Effective management of your bankroll is essential for enjoying a longer and more rewarding gambling experience. By implementing a few key strategies, you can ensure that your funds last longer, allowing you to play more and increase your chances of winning. One fundamental rule is to set a strict budget for each gaming session. Determine how much you are willing to spend and stick to it, regardless of your wins or losses. Avoid dipping into your savings or using funds meant for essentials, as this can lead to reckless behavior and potential financial issues.
Another viable tactic is to divide your bankroll into smaller portions for each session or type of game. This allows you to manage your wagers effectively and prevents you from blowing through your funds quickly. For example, if you have a total bankroll of $300, consider breaking it down into smaller chunks as follows:
Session | Portion | Game Type |
---|---|---|
Session 1 | $100 | Slots |
Session 2 | $100 | Blackjack |
Session 3 | $100 | Roulette |
By allocating specific amounts for each game type, you can stay focused and intentional in your play, while also giving yourself a structured approach to your gambling sessions. Furthermore, always remember to take regular breaks. This will help you stay mentally fresh and avoid making impulsive decisions that can quickly deplete your bankroll.
Responsible Gambling: Recognizing Limits and Avoiding Pitfalls
Engaging in gambling can be an exciting diversion, but it’s essential to approach it with awareness and caution. Recognizing your limits is paramount; establish a budget before you start playing. Allocate a specific amount of money that you can afford to lose without impacting your daily life or financial responsibilities. Always keep track of your spending and time spent gambling by considering the following tips:
- Set a Time Limit: Decide how long you want to gamble and stick to that schedule.
- Know Your Game: Understand the rules and odds of the games you’re playing to make informed choices.
- Take Breaks: Step away regularly to reassess your experience and emotions.
Equally important is the ability to identify potential pitfalls that could lead to unhealthy gambling habits. Take time to reflect on your emotional state and recognize the signs of problem gambling.
